Definition of trainable - Reverso English Dictionary

Adjective

1.
learning abilityRareable to learn or be taught new thingsRare
  • Some dogs are very trainable and learn tricks quickly.
teachable
2.
animal trainingTECH.able to learn tasks through conditioningTECH.
  • Horses are trainable for various equestrian activities.
biddable tractable
